> Because the D-Link cards were less than half of the nearest
> competitor [ < $180 vs > $360 for others and Compac was > $2400! ] I
> ordered only three not knowing for sure if they would work. Turned on
> the tulip driver and them suckers fired right up. Now I know they work,
> stock, right out of the box, and I can order a bunch more for the lab
> I'm working with.

I use those cards in all routers here and they work extremely well.
But I don't use the standard vanilla tulip driver that's in the official
kernel. I use an optimized version that handled high traffic volumes much
better, it decreases the interrupt-load quite a lot. (this driver is about
to be merged with the standard tulip driver IIRC)
I havn't had any problems with these cards so I can really recommend them.
